About
As morning dawns on an infamous Monday in late August, Katrina laughs with delight as she slams into the Louisiana coast, tossing homes and trees like they were toys, and destroying everything that dares to cross her path.
When she arrives in New Orleans, she taps her feet and claps her hands as if she were at Mardi Gras in a second line dance. But this is no second line; her strength punctures the levees like a knife pierces arteries, and water gushes like blood to bury the city.
She leaves behind a horror yet to be fathomed.
But the horrors beyond that of lives lost and families ruined were the layers of corruption that had been sealed behind the closed doors of government, only to be opened and peeled back by the travails of Katrina.
